About MultiCare Cancer Institute
MultiCare Cancer Institute is a physician-led, multi-specialty group within MultiCare Health System, delivering integrated hematology, oncology, radiation, surgical and supportive care across Washington state. Each year, we diagnose and treat more than 6,000 new cancer cases across Olympia, Spokane, Tacoma and Yakima.
We bring together advanced pathology, imaging and evidence-based treatment with holistic supportive services to provide personalized, high-quality cancer care. As we continue to grow, we are building the Pacific Northwest's most comprehensive and high-value oncology network-projected to double in volume over the next five years.

A vibrant, welcoming community rooted in culture, agriculture, and connection Academic energy and growth anchored by Pacific Northwest University of Health Sciences Heart of Washington wine country with award-winning wineries and outdoor dining experiences Ideal central location for weekend getaways to Seattle, the mountains, or nearby lakes Enjoy all four seasons with over 300 days of sunshine and endless outdoor recreation About MultiCare Health System MultiCare is a not-for-profit health care organization with more than 20,000 team members, including employees, providers and volunteers. MultiCare has been caring for our community for well over a century, since the founding of Tacoma's first hospital and today is the largest community-based, locally governed system of health in the state of Washington, serving communities across Washington and Northern Idaho.
